diff --git a/app/root.tsx b/app/root.tsx index c56ad81..ad87a5d 100644 --- a/app/root.tsx +++ b/app/root.tsx @@ -140,16 +140,16 @@ export async function loader({ request }: LoaderFunctionArgs) { responseHeaders["Set-Cookie"] = await sessionStorage.commitSession(refreshedSession); } - // 向组件传递认证状态、当前路径和环境变量 + // 向组件传递认证状态、当前路径 + // 注意:不再传递 Dify 相关环境变量,客户端改为调用 Remix API routes return Response.json({ isAuthenticated, userRole, pathname, frontendJWT, ENV: { - NEXT_PUBLIC_API_URL: process.env.NEXT_PUBLIC_API_URL, - NEXT_PUBLIC_APP_ID: process.env.NEXT_PUBLIC_APP_ID, - NEXT_PUBLIC_APP_KEY: process.env.NEXT_PUBLIC_APP_KEY, + // 移除 NEXT_PUBLIC_API_URL, NEXT_PUBLIC_APP_ID, NEXT_PUBLIC_APP_KEY + // 客户端不再需要直接调用 Dify API }, }, { headers: responseHeaders